Taupo Society Of Arts Meets To See Two Films
The recently-formed Taupo Society of Arts held its first meeting last week when most of the 40 members wratched instructiop films from the National Film Library. The films were The Artists Proof and Potter's World. The society's committee has drawn up the year's programme of activities. In July there will be a landscape painting trip; a criticism evening will be held in August. The meeting in September will cater for sculpture enthusiasts and in October the society will hold its first
, display of work, which wrill be open to members and guests only. In November the last landscape trip of the year will be held and the year will finish with another film evening. There was a suggestion at the last meeting that the society might hold an arts ball later in the year. Plans for this may be discussed at future meetings. The group meets at the Taupo-nui-a-Tia College on the second Monday of each | month and prospective mem!bers are welcome to attend. - . . ■
